USA: in Grand Junction, all municipal vehicles are fuelled by biomethane/RNG
Sustainable mobility
The biogas is purified and upgraded in order to be turned into biomethane/RNG, with the process features varying according to the feedstocks and the type of digester. The city of Grand Junction, Colorado, purifies the biogas obtained from the WWT plant to create biomethane and power the whole municipal fleet: refuse trucks, buses, street sweepers and other municipal vehicles.
